Position Summary: The Paralegal is responsible for maintaining the
integrity of the file materials on each assigned file, preparing
file materials for scheduled events for each Expert, creating a
summary of the pertinent file materials in accordance with standard
practice, and identifying missing file information and coordinating
its acquisition from the client. Essential Functions: Performs
daily work assignments in a high quality manner including, but not
limited to, review of file materials and preparation of the
Preliminary File Summary; maintaining file integrity on a file by
file basis. Completes daily work assignments in a timely manner
with respect to deadlines and event dates. This area includes,
review and assessment of file for missing materials; preparation of
file for deposition/trial. Completes daily work assignments
productively and within budgeted time allotted. Communicates with
others involved on assigned files and works as a team so that
complete and responsive client service is provided, including:
coordination with others to request materials; acquiring duces
tecum notices; coordination with other divisions and departments.
Maintains routine contact with clients to ensure necessary
information is received in an appropriate time frame. Uses the
Matter Management System to manage personal case load with respect
to task status and deadlines, event status and dates, priorities,
et cetera, and to communicate file-related information to the rest
of the organization. Required Education and Experience: Associates
Degree, Baccalaureate Degree or American Bar Association approved
certification in paralegal studies required. A minimum of three
years of paralegal experience in product liability, medical
malpractice or personal injury environments or equivalent
experience required. Must be able to read 60 deposition pages in
one hour. Must be able to summarize and synthesize information
without changing the underlying facts or inferences. Powered by
